VA DSCR Programs : Qualifying Without Standard Wages

Finding a home in Virginia can be tough, especially if you don’t possess conventional income proof. Thankfully, the Virginia DSCR (Debt Service Coverage Ratio) option presents a great opportunity for buyers who are self-employed , have irregular earnings, or don't want to use past check here W-2 earnings . Instead of focusing on your your wages, DSCR programs evaluate the proportion of your investment real estate's income to its loan liabilities, permitting eligible individuals to acquire a home even with a absence of traditional wages record. Unlock Homeownership: Virginia FHA Loan Options

Dreaming of getting a house in Virginia? Discover the possibilities with Federal Housing Administration loan programs! These options are created to support new homebuyers and individuals with limited down payment savings . Virginia FHA mortgages typically demand as little as 3.5% upfront payment and offer easier credit qualifications , making homeownership substantially attainable to a greater range of residents across the state . Virginia FHA and DSCR Loans – Which is Right for You?

Navigating the home loan landscape in Virginia can be confusing, especially when deciding between an FHA home purchase and a DSCR mortgage. FHA programs are federally guaranteed, often making them available for potential homebuyers with reduced credit scores and smaller cash contributions. They require ongoing insurance payments regardless of your credit rating. DSCR programs, on the other hand, focus primarily on your cash flow to qualify, ignoring your credit score. This can be advantageous for those with damaged credit. Here's a quick look:

  • FHA: Reduced credit score requirements, smaller down payment options, demands mortgage insurance.
  • DSCR: Focuses on property earnings, potentially easier approval for those with credit challenges, might have higher interest rates.
